Many highly industrialized countries are rapidly adopting "new" environmental policy instruments (NEPIs) such as eco-taxes, tradable permits, voluntary agreements and eco-labels. Over the last decade there have been major changes in patterns of international defence diplomacy. Defence diplomacy - peacetime military cooperation and assistance - has traditionally been used for realpolitik purposes of strengthening allies against common enemies.
